Established by MD Financial Management Inc. and Scotiabank, the Medicus Pension Plan is currently open to incorporated physicians in Alberta, British Columbia, Newfoundland and Labrador, Nova Scotia, Ontario, Prince Edward Island, and the Territories.
The Director, Funding & Investments, Medicus Pension Plan leads and oversees funding, investments, and financial stewardship for the Medicus Pension Plan ensuring the Plan’s financial position is well managed, sustainable, and aligned with strategic objectives and regulatory requirements.
Is this role right for you? In this role, you will:
Lead and drives a customer focused culture throughout their team to deepen client relationships and leverage broader Bank relationships, systems and knowledge.
Lead and drives a culture of strong financial stewardship, supporting prudent funding, investment oversight, and long‑term sustainability of the Medicus Pension Plan.
Support the Administrative Board in establishing, monitoring, and overseeing investment strategy, including asset allocation, investment performance, and compliance with the Statement of Investment Policies and Procedures (SIPP).
Oversee actuarial valuations, assumptions, and funding strategy in partnership with the Plan Actuary.
Evaluate funding risks, benefit sustainability, and regulatory compliance, and provides clear analysis and recommendations to the Administrative Board and executive leadership.
Oversee preparation of trust fund financial statements and coordination of the annual audit, ensuring accuracy, completeness, and timely delivery.
Lead budgeting, forecasting, and financial planning processes to support effective decision‑making and strategic planning.
Ensure strong financial controls and compliance with applicable accounting standards, regulatory requirements, and internal financial policies.
Oversee relationships with key external service providers, including actuarial, audit, and investment partners.
Collaborate closely with peer Directors to align funding, investment, and financial considerations into enterprise strategy, planning, risk management, and operations.

Do you have the skills that will enable you to succeed in this role? - We'd love to work with you if you have:
University degree in finance, accounting, economics, actuarial science, or a related discipline.
Professional designation (e.g., CPA, CFA, FSA/FCIA) is a strong asset.
10+ years of leadership experience in pension funding, investments, finance, or actuarial oversight.
Strong knowledge of pension funding and investment rules, and financial reporting standards.
Demonstrated experience supporting boards or committees in financial and investment matters.
Excellent analytical, communication, and stakeholder‑management skills.
